Aaron Yetter feels there's more for him in life than what he sees living in an Amish community. He loves technology and sports, both of which are taboo for the People. He has a choice to make: does he travel to a Cleveland courthouse to try and find his biological parents, or does he take his baptismal vows and become a member of the church. That is what his adoptive parents, Justus and Anna Yetter, would like. His father suffers a heart attack making Aaron feel guilty that he may have brought it on, so he is feeling the need to stay to help with the chores. His older adopted sisters, Mary and Esther, support Aaron in his quest, but not his older brother, Vernon, who is the Yetters only biological son. The battle between them is the catalyst to Aaron having to leave all that he knows. His journey will take him to the big city of Cleveland to begin the search for his biological parents and for himself. The people he meets along the way will help him and hurt him; it's a journey of dark and light. As the holidays grow near, Aaron feels more alone than ever and wonders if he made a mistake in leaving his Amish home. Will God reveal His plan to Aaron before the New Year?
